Another former turd looking for work: Jamon Brown, G, Giants. Age: 26.

Jamon Brown has been a starter for the Rams and Giants over the past couple of years. Brown's not horrible, but he shouldn't be a starter. That said, he's only 26 in March, so he still has some potential.

Rams' Andrew Whitworth: Decides to continue playing
Rotowire 1D ago
Whitworth will continue his football career in 2019, Albert Breer of TheMMQB.com reports.

The 37-year-old left tackle will return to Los Angeles for the final season of a three-year, $36 million contract, providing some stability along the offensive line for a team that may lose left guard Rodger Saffold in free agency. Whitworth is still one of the league's best at his position and hasn't missed a game due to injury since 2013 in Cincinnati. With 195 regular-season starts and two First-Team All Pro selections to his name, Whitworth quietly has built a solid case for the Hall of Fame.

"After Gurley ran for 115 yards and one touchdown against the Dallas Cowboys in the NFC divisional round, he amassed only 45 total rushing yards during his last two playoff games"

I keep reading quotes like this but people are missing the fact that CJ didn't set the world on fire in those two games either. Sometimes your run game can be beaten.
I believe he will be fine. 100% next season and with CJ to spell him he should be as dangerous as ever.
